Ok so I did not get my answer before leaving work and I had to go home and measure em. Well if nayone else ever needs to know this the TIIs have the heavy duty brakes. Or the length is 12 and 5/8". There was 2 different brake hoses and I did not know. I dont know how they get this info of heavy duty and what not.
